Where is Santa Rosa Station?
Santa Rosa Station is located in San Ramón. If you want to find things to do in the area, you may want to check out Costanera Center and Estadio Monumental David Arellano.
Things to see and do near Santa Rosa Station
What to see near Santa Rosa Station
- Costanera Center
- Estadio Monumental David Arellano
- Julio Martinez Pradanos National Stadium
- O'Higgins Park
- Movistar Arena
Things to do near Santa Rosa Station
- Mall Plaza Oeste
- Fantasilandia
- Concha Y Toro Winery
- Lastarria District
- National Museum of Fine Arts